ITV's Lorraine Kelly, a household name with over 40 years in the television industry, is best known for her stints on Good Morning Britain and GMTV. She now hosts her own programme, 'Lorraine', where she engages with celebrities, delves into current affairs, and explores topics from fashion to food.

Away from the spotlight of her show, Lorraine has been involved in life-saving campaigns and numerous charity endeavours. Her efforts in philanthropy and journalism have earned her a CBE , reports the Mirror.

Throughout her illustrious career and charitable pursuits, one person has remained a constant support – her husband Steve Smith. The couple has enjoyed a 32-year marriage, which began when they met at TV-am, where Steve was working as a cameraman.

While Lorraine is a familiar face to many, Steve prefers to keep a lower profile. Here's a glimpse into the enduring relationship between Lorraine Kelly and Steve Smith after three decades.

How did Lorraine Kelly meet her husband?

It all started at TV-am, where Lorraine instantly knew Steve was "the one" upon seeing him. Recounting to Woman and Home, Lorraine reminisced: "He walked into the TV-am office 28 years ago where I was working as a reporter and he was part of the crew, and I thought, 'That'll do, I'm having that.'".

The pair were pals for a whole year before romance blossomed. Their relationship took a turn during a work trip to Glencoe, Scotland.

Lorraine has previously recounted: "We were staying in a tiny hotel in the middle of nowhere and I got him incredibly drunk on tequila before making my move."

She humorously added, "The way I remember it is that I leapt on him like a ninja and he had absolutely no defence! ".

Lorraine's blissful union with Steve began officially when they tied the knot on September 5, 1992, at Mains Castle in Dundee. A couple of years into their marriage, they welcomed their daughter Rosie into the world.

While Lorraine is a familiar face on TV, Steve prefers to keep out of the spotlight. Lorraine has said that Steve gets the "funny hours and the silliness" that come with her celebrity status but has no interest in being part of it himself.

She believes this understanding is crucial to their lasting marriage. Lorraine has also shared, "His idea of hell on earth would be at something like a premiere. It would be like having needles stuck in his eyes. That does help. It must be very odd being with someone who enjoys walking down a red carpet."

Earlier this year, the couple received exciting news as their 29-year-old daughter Rosie announced her pregnancy. Rosie expressed her joy, saying: "We could not be more excited – you're already so loved little one."

She also shared a photo of her 12-week sonogram scan, revealing that her baby was now 'the size of a fig'.

Rosie has given birth to little Billie on August 29, sparking joy in the family. On social media, an elated Lorraine couldn't contain her excitement as she exclaimed: "I have been BURSTING to share this wonderful news with you. " "Baby Billie is an angel and I'm so proud of @rosiekellysmith and @stevewhite94 who will be the best parents."

She added: "I'm delighted to be Granny Smith and can't wait to go on adventures."

Lorraine Kelly's personal life often captures attention, especially since she resides in a picturesque riverside abode. After living in Dundee, Lorraine and her husband Steve moved to Buckinghamshire back in 2017 when their daughter Rosie flew the nest.

The move was principally driven by Lorraine's demanding job in London, which used to involve frequent travel. Their current home is estimated to be worth around £2 million and showcases the couple's refined tastes.

Social media glimpses into their home reveal a spacious kitchen, several bedrooms, a cosy living room that features a log burner, and a conservatory bathed in natural light.

Their sprawling garden isn't without its charms either, boasting a dedicated guest house that welcomes visiting friends and relatives.
